PAX Australia will be held in Melbourne from October 30 to November 1, 2015. Unfortunately, I'll be travelling at the time, but what about you guys? Anyone planning to attend?
What is PAX Australia? PAX was originally established in 2004 as a weekend-long celebration of gamer culture. In 2013, the first PAX Australia was held at the Melbourne Showgrounds to a sold-out crowd. To cater for larger numbers, the event was moved to the Melbourne Convention and Exhibition Centre in 2014, and once again will be held there this year.
